质数与合数
19. 有多少个正整数除 152,余数为 8?
解: 一个正整数除 152,余数为 8,则这个数一定是
152-8=144 的约数.
问题转化为:求 144 的约数中,大于 8 的约数个数.
152-8=144=24×3²,
共有 (4+1)×(2+1)=15 个约数.
其中 6 个约数
1、2、3、4、6、8
不大于 8.
所以符合题意的数共有 15-8=7 个.
20. 由正整数组成的有序数组 (a,b,c) 中,满足 abc=106 的有多少组?
解: 由 abc=106 可设
其中 αi、βi (i=1,2,3) 为非负整数,
并且 α1+α2+α3=6,
β1+β2+β3=6.
注意到 α1+α2+α3=6
的非负整数解 (α1,α2,α3) 共有
8×7/2=28 组.
所以,满足条件的 (a,b,c) 共有
28²=784 组.
21. 设 a1, a2,…, a10 为正整数,a1210 中.将 ak 的不等于自身的最大约数记为 bk.
已知:b1>b2>…>b10,
证明:a10>500.
解: 令 bk=ak/ck,ck 是 ak 最小素因数.
因为 b9>b10,
得 b9>1,b9≥c9.
由此,a10>a9≥c9².
由不等式 aii+1,
bi>bi+1,
得 cii+1.
故 c1≥2,c2≥3,c3≥5,…,c9≥23.
这推出 a10>c9²≥529>500.
22. 求所有的正整数 m、n,使得 m²+1 是一个质数,且10(m²+1)=n²+1.
解: 由已知条件知:
9(m²+1)=(n-m)(n+m),
注意到 m²+1是一个质数,故 m²+1 不是 3 的倍数,所以
n-m=1,
n+m=9(m²+1);
n-m=3,
n+m=3(m²+1);
n-m=9,
n+m=m²+1;
n-m=m²+1,
n+m=9.
(1) 若n-m=1,
n+m=9(m²+1)
将两式相减,分别可得
9m²+8=2m,不可能.
(2) 若 n-m=3,
n+m=3(m²+1)
将两式相减,分别可得
3m²=2m,不可能.
(3) 若 n-m=9,
n+m=m²+1,
将两式相减,分别可得
m²-8=2m,
故 m=4.
(4) 若 n-m=m²+1,
n+m=9
将两式相减,分别可得
m²-8=-2m,
故 m=2.
当 m=2 或者 m=4 时,
m²+1 分别是 5 和 17 均为素数,
此时对应的 n 分别为 7 和 13.
所以,满足条件的 (m,n)=(2,7) 或者 (4,13).
23. 设 m 是一个小于 2006 的四位数,已知存在正整数 n,使得 m-n 为质数,且 mn 是一个完全平方数,
求满足条件的所有四位数 m.
解: 由题设条件知:
m-n=p,p 是质数,
则 m=n+p,
设 mn=n(n+p)=x²,其中x是正整数,
那么 4n²+4pn=4x²,
即 (2n+p)²-p²=(2x)²,
于是 (2n-2x+p)(2n+2x+p)=p²
注意到 p 为质数,所以
2n-2x+p=1,
2n+2x+p=p²
把两式相加得
n=[(p-1)/2]2,
进而 m=[(p+1)/2]2,
结合 1000≤m<2006,
可得 64≤p+1≤89,
于是,质数 p 只能是
67、71、73、79 或 83.
从而,满足条件的 m 为
1156、1296、1369、1600、1764.
完
三连一下,一起过冬天~